In a significant turn of events, the Labour Party (LP) has officially dropped its petition challenging the election of Rivers State Governor, Sim Fubara, who ran under the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) banner during the 2023 gubernatorial poll.
Beatrice Itubo, LP’s governorship candidate in the state, disclosed the withdrawal of the petition in an exclusive interview with Channels Television on Saturday.
Itubo not only conveyed the party’s decision to abandon the legal challenge but also pledged support for Governor Fubara’s administration, emphasizing a commitment to the progress of Rivers State.

The LP’s initial petition against Fubara’s victory had been dismissed by the Appeal Court sitting in Lagos, affirming the legitimacy of the PDP candidate’s election.
This development comes amid a broader political crisis in Rivers State, marked by tensions between Governor Fubara and his predecessor, Federal Capital Territory (FCT) Minister Nyesom Wike.
